A simple, quick, and budget-friendly Passover breakfast scramble combining eggs and matzo for a comforting and traditional meal.
Use room temperature eggs for fluffier scramble. Toast matzo before adding eggs for best texture. Cook on medium to medium-low heat to avoid rubbery eggs and burnt matzo. Gently fold eggs instead of stirring vigorously. Season gradually as matzo absorbs salt quickly. Variations include adding vegetables, spices, or using gluten-free matzo or sweet potato slices for gluten-free option.
